Spare no efforts to bring culprits to justice: Guv over Bhaderwah incident | KNO

Urges people of Bhaderwah to remain calm

Srinagar, May 17 (KNO) : Governor Satya Pal Malik has condemned the loss of a precious life in an unfortunate incident at Bhaderwah in Doda district. Governor has urged the people not to take law and order in their hand and co-operate with the law enforcing agencies. He has advised the prominent leaders of the town to help the Police and Civil administration in pacifying the protestors. Meanwhile, Governor has directed the Police and Civil administration to spare no efforts in bringing the culprits to justice and ensure that no anti-social element succeed in exploiting the situation and shatter the sense of brotherhood and harmony existing among the people of Bhaderwah since centuries.(KNO)
